1998 Ferrari 355 Spider vs. 1998 Nissan Silvia

To start off, both 1998 Ferrari 355 Spider and 1998 Nissan Silvia were released in the same year (1998).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 3,494 cc (8 cylinders), 1998 Ferrari 355 Spider is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1998 Ferrari 355 Spider (375 HP @ 8250 RPM) has 125 more horse power than 1998 Nissan Silvia. (250 HP @ 3600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1998 Ferrari 355 Spider should accelerate faster than 1998 Nissan Silvia.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1998 Ferrari 355 Spider (363 Nm) has 92 more torque (in Nm) than 1998 Nissan Silvia. (271 Nm). This means 1998 Ferrari 355 Spider will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1998 Nissan Silvia.

Compare all specifications:

1998 Ferrari 355 Spider 1998 Nissan Silvia
Make Ferrari Nissan
Model 355 Spider Silvia
Year Released 1998 1998
Body Type Convertible Coupe
Engine Position Middle Front
Engine Size 3494 cc 1998 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 5 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 375 HP 250 HP
Engine RPM 8250 RPM 3600 RPM
Torque 363 Nm 271 Nm
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 2 seats 2 seats
Vehicle Length 4260 mm 4450 mm
Vehicle Width 1910 mm 1700 mm
Vehicle Height 1180 mm 1290 mm
Wheelbase Size 2460 mm 2530 mm
